We have been both time frames and Easter week is FAR more crowded than the week leading up to Christmas. We were there Easter week in 2010 ~ MK was in phased closing 3 days; the day we were in Epcot it was 180 minute waits for Test Track and Soarin' :eek: We vowed no more Easter.
